Sound Slide is a rythm puzzle racer, bringing you to 4 different environments around the world! Each environment has its own distinctive music: go with the flow and hop from lane to lane to get to the end!

Pros
- Free to play
- Engaging rhythm gameplay
- Good music and visuals
- Adjustable difficulty and modifiers
- Potential for skill development
Cons
- Limited content with only 4 levels
- Audio and input synchronization issues
- Lack of customization and user-generated content
- No multiplayer or social features
- Performance and optimization problems on some systems
